2. Obsessive-Compulsive Disorder
This condition (OCD) makes you feel anxious and have thoughts and urges you just can't stop. For example, you might wash your hands over and over again. You might doubt yourself a lot and take a long time to finish simple tasks.
3. Parkinson's Disease
While it might start as a little shakiness in the hand, Parkinson's can eventually affect how you walk, talk, sleep, and think. Even early on, it can lead to things like obsessing over small details or a sudden carelessness.
4. Bipolar Disorder
This causes mood changes that go way beyond the normal ups and downs of life. When you're up, you might feel jumpy, talk really fast & take big risks. When you're down, you might be worried, have low energy & feel worthless. Sometimes, it might be a mix.
5. Thyroid Disease
The thyroid makes hormones that tell your body how fast or slow to work. If it makes too much of those, it can feel like someone stomped on the gas pedal. You might be irritable, anxious, and have big mood swings.
6. Depression
As it comes on, this reaches into every part of your life. It not only affects your mood, but also the kinds of things you think about, your memory, and how you make decisions. It changes how you think about the world around you.
7. Traumatic Brain Injury
After a serious blow to the head, changes in personality can be a hidden symptom that happens over time. In more serious cases, you may seem like a different person, saying or doing things you never would have in the past.
8. Dementia With Lewy Bodies
After Alzheimer's, this is the next most common type of dementia. Clumps of unusual proteins called Lewy bodies, form in the areas of your brain that control memory, movement, and thinking. So it affects you both mentally and physically.
9. Multiple Sclerosis (MS)
This causes the immune system to attack nerves in the brain & spine. It can cause problems ranging from bladder issues to immobility. In some cases, it can lead to a feeling of euphoria, where happiness is beyond normal and out of touch with reality.
10. Alzheimer's Disease
This illness affects thinking, judgment, memory, and decision-making. It can make people feel confused and change how they act. Early on, you may be anxious or more easily annoyed. Over time, it can have more serious effects.

The BBL procedure starts with liposuction of a different area, often the abdomen, flanks, thighs or back.
The fat removed from these areas is then injected into the hips and buttocks to improve shape and projection. #AvonsPracticalTips#HealthyLiving
2. BBL can be dangerous
The keyword is 'can'.
Although it is generally safe, there is a risk of fat getting into major blood vessels and clogging them when being injected. #AvonsPracticalTips#HealthyLiving
